Output 36d3d9c15c5a54c0aea749d32f577cfed49b42bf32634a9d4dd369566cc7bfe8:2

value
1043066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b3aaa4e5e483d3e439b2573f40f92f7fe2a5235 OP_EQUAL
address
3BTzWCjsNqzqEhNGH2akd663FQnEQjbzvM
transaction
36d3d9c15c5a54c0aea749d32f577cfed49b42bf32634a9d4dd369566cc7bfe8
spent
true